instrucciones_sql 1
Sintaxis de SELECT
Una de las sentencias SQL más importantes es SELECT, ya que permite realizar consultas sobre
los datos almacenados en la base de datos.
SELECT
[ALL | DISTINCT |DISTINCTROW ]
[FROM table_references
[WHERE where_definition]
[GROUP BY {col_name | expr | position}
[ASC | DESC], ... [WITH ROLLUP]]
[HAVING where_definition]
[ORDER BY {col_name | expr | position}[ASC | DESC] , ...]
El operador BETWEEN se utiliza en la cláusula WHERE para seleccionar valores entre un rango
de datos.
Sintaxis de SQL BETWEEN
SELECT columna
FROM tabla WHERE columna
BETWEEN valor1AND valor2
Ejemplo de SQL BETWEEN
Dada la siguiente tabla 'personas'
nombre
apellido1
apellido2
ANTONIO
PEREZ
GOMEZ
ANTONIO
GARCIA
RODRIGUEZ
PEDRO
RUIZ
GONZALEZ
El operador LIKE permiteutilizar caracteres comodín en la búsqueda de
un patrón dentro de una columna. Un caracter comodín es aquel que no
coincide con un caracter específico si no con cualquier caracter o
caracteres.
Eloperador LIKE selecciona valores alfanuméricos con un determinado
patrón.
SINTAXIS DEL OPERADOR SQL LIKE
SELECT column_name(s)
FROM table_name
WHERE column_name LIKE pattern;
La clave externa o FOREIGNKEY, es una columna o varias columnas, que sirven para señalar
cual es la clave primaria de otra tabla.
La columna o columnas señaladas como FOREIGN KEY, solo podrán tener valores que ya existan
en laclave primaria PRIMARY KEY de la otra tabla.
Ejemplo de FOREIGN KEY
Ejemplo FOREIGN KEY con ALTER TABLE
ALTER TABLE ADD FOREIGN KEY (dep) REFERENCES departamentos(dep)
La sentencia SQL UNION esutilizada para acumular los resultados de dos sentencias SELECT.
Las dos sentencias SELECT tienen que tener el mismo número de columnas, con el mismo tipo de
dato y en el mismo orden.
Sintaxis SQL UNIONSELECT columna1, columna2 FROM tabla1
UNION
SELECT columna1, columna2 FROM tabla2
La sentencia UPDATE se utiliza para actualizar registros ya existentes de
una tabla.
Nos permite elegir los campos...
Regístrate para leer el documento completo.